Examples of indenture trustee in a sentence

  • Any resale, pledge or other transfer of any of the Notes contrary to the restrictions set forth above and elsewhere in this Indenture shall be deemed void ab initio by the Issuer and Indenture Trustee.

  • The Indenture Trustee initially shall be the Note Registrar for the purpose of registering Notes and transfers of Notes as herein provided.

  • All cancelled Notes may be held or disposed of by the Indenture Trustee in accordance with its standard retention or disposal policy as in effect at the time unless the Issuer shall direct by an Issuer Order that they be returned to it; provided, that such Issuer Order is timely and the Notes have not been previously disposed of by the Indenture Trustee.

  • The Issuer may at any time deliver to the Indenture Trustee for cancellation any Notes previously authenticated and delivered hereunder which the Issuer may have acquired in any manner whatsoever, and all Notes so delivered shall be promptly cancelled by the Indenture Trustee.

  • The Indenture Trustee shall use “CUSIP” numbers in notices of redemption as a convenience to Noteholders; provided, that any such notice may state that no representation is made as to the correctness of such “CUSIP” numbers either as printed on the Notes or as contained in any notice of a redemption and that reliance may be placed only on the other identification numbers printed on the Notes and any such redemption shall not be affected by any defect in or omission of such numbers.
